In Romania, the government of the National Liberal Party (PNL) and the Hungarian-Romanian Democratic Alliance (DAHR), led by Liberal Prime Minister Florin Seto, failed in a parliamentary vote on Tuesday. Before the meeting, the opposition Social Democrats placed a doll of Superman in front of the office of the incumbent Prime Minister.

281 deputies and senators voted on a motion of censure from the opposition Social Democratic Party. It took at least 234 votes to overthrow the government.

The downfall of the Cabinet was due to an open conflict with the Prime Minister, the Romania Rescue Alliance (USR), who resigned from the government in early September and, by voting in a motion of no-confidence, proved that without him the Cabinet had no parliamentary support.

Before the session began, the PSD deputies put Superman on his head in front of the conference room. This refers to a clip the Prime Minister recently posted on his Facebook page, depicting himself as Superman.

The liberals took Molyneux with them with the caption: USR plus AUR (Right-Right Populist Party and Nationalist Alliance for the Unification of Romanians, ed.) Equal PSD.

The government’s censure motion called for immediate departure so that Romania can “recover from the ongoing political, economic and social crisis”, the Transindex.ro online portal reported.

Next, the head of state, Klaus Iohannis, will have to negotiate with the parties on the installation of a new government, while the Seto government will lead the country as a business deputy.
